package sshd
import (
"bytes"
"crypto/rand"
"crypto/rsa"
"io"
"testing"
"golang.org/x/crypto/ssh"
)
// TODO: Move some of these into their own package?
func MakeKey(bits int) (ssh.Signer, error) {
key, err := rsa.GenerateKey(rand.Reader, bits)
if err != nil {
return nil, err
}
return ssh.NewSignerFromKey(key)
}
func NewClientSession(host string, name string, handler func(r io.Reader, w io.WriteCloser)) error {
config := &ssh.ClientConfig{
User: name,
Auth: []ssh.AuthMethod{
ssh.KeyboardInteractive(func(user, instruction string, questions []string, echos []bool) (answers []string, err error) {
return
}),
},
}
conn, err := ssh.Dial("tcp", host, config)
if err != nil {
return err
}
defer conn.Close()
session, err := conn.NewSession()
if err != nil {
return err
}
defer session.Close()
in, err := session.StdinPipe()
if err != nil {
return err
}
out, err := session.StdoutPipe()
if err != nil {
return err
}
err = session.Shell()
if err != nil {
return err
}
handler(out, in)
return nil
}
func TestServerInit(t *testing.T) {
config := MakeNoAuth()
s, err := ListenSSH(":badport", config)
if err == nil {
t.Fatal("should fail on bad port")
}
s, err = ListenSSH(":0", config)
if err != nil {
t.Error(err)
}
err = s.Close()
if err != nil {
t.Error(err)
}
}
func TestServeTerminals(t *testing.T) {
signer, err := MakeKey(512)
config := MakeNoAuth()
config.AddHostKey(signer)
s, err := ListenSSH(":0", config)
if err != nil {
t.Fatal(err)
}
terminals := s.ServeTerminal()
go func() {
// Accept one terminal, read from it, echo back, close.
term := <-terminals
term.SetPrompt("> ")
line, err := term.ReadLine()
if err != nil {
t.Error(err)
}
_, err = term.Write([]byte("echo: " + line + "\r\n"))
if err != nil {
t.Error(err)
}
term.Close()
}()
host := s.Addr().String()
name := "foo"
err = NewClientSession(host, name, func(r io.Reader, w io.WriteCloser) {
// Consume if there is anything
buf := new(bytes.Buffer)
w.Write([]byte("hello\r\n"))
buf.Reset()
_, err := io.Copy(buf, r)
if err != nil {
t.Error(err)
}
expected := "> hello\r\necho: hello\r\n"
actual := buf.String()
if actual != expected {
t.Errorf("Got `%s`; expected `%s`", actual, expected)
}
s.Close()
})
if err != nil {
t.Fatal(err)
}
}
